David Lyman to Speak on the Human Impact of Technological Advancement

Rotary Club of Bangkapi

Technology is rapidly advancing in ways that would have seemed entirely inconceivable to those living only a few short decades ago. New inventions are constantly changing the way we live, and they have had a significant impact on the course of human history. Something as small and seemingly insignificant as the mobile phone has defined generations, has spurred on new cultures, and has mobilized international integration among countries. Without a doubt, technological development is one of the most significant aspects of our lives, and it is important for us to recognize and appreciate this fact. David Lyman, chairman and chief values officer of Tilleke & Gibbins, will be speaking on these subjects in a presentation dubbed “Change—Yesterday, Today, Tomorrow,” at a luncheon organized by the Rotary Club of Bangkapi.

The Rotary Club of Bangkapi will hold the luncheon at the Grand Hyatt Erawan hotel in Bangkok, on March 11, and David will be speaking from 12.30 p.m. to 1.30 p.m. The discussion will be followed by a Q&A session. For more information, please contact Pinta Punsoni at [email protected].
